Understanding Corporate Actions
Corporate actions are events initiated by publicly traded companies that can significantly affect the price of their securities. These actions can be categorized into four main types: dividends and distributions, share capital alterations, corporate reconfigurations, and other meaningful actions. An example discussed is Nvidia's recent stock split, which aimed to make shares more accessible to retail investors after significant price increases. Such splits often lead to increased demand, theoretically driving the stock price higher, despite the overall equity value remaining unchanged.
Processing Corporate Actions Efficiently
Timely and accurate processing of corporate actions is crucial for effective investment management. Many corporate actions, such as share buybacks or dividend payments, occur with little or no prior notice, requiring investors to be well-prepared for sudden developments. Investors should conduct thorough research to anticipate potential corporate actions based on company fundamentals, such as cash reserves. A practical example highlighted is the handling of a lawsuit by a small-cap company, where prior knowledge allowed for swift decision-making when the lawsuit was dismissed, resulting in a significant stock price increase.
The Complexity of Mergers and Acquisitions
Mergers and acquisitions (M&A) represent some of the most intricate corporate actions, often involving multiple stakeholders and regulatory approvals. The recent acquisition of Activision Blizzard by Microsoft exemplified the lengthy and uncertain nature of M&A processes, which can lead to significant variation in stock prices as the deal progresses. Investors face challenges navigating these situations due to potential insider information and the complex reactions of the market. Issues such as cultural integration and regulatory response can further complicate M&A outcomes, making a thorough analysis essential for investors.
